The Growing Role of Artificial Intelligence in Healthcare
Artificial Intelligence is becoming an integral part of modern healthcare systems. AI algorithms can process large volumes of healthcare data faster than humans, identifying patterns and correlations that might otherwise go unnoticed.
Healthcare organizations use AI technologies to support clinical decision-making, improve patient monitoring, automate administrative tasks, and accelerate medical research. These technologies enable doctors to diagnose diseases earlier and provide more targeted treatment strategies.
One of the most significant benefits of AI in healthcare is its ability to analyze diverse datasets such as medical imaging, electronic health records (EHR), genetic data, and wearable device data simultaneously. This multimodal analysis allows healthcare professionals to detect diseases earlier and develop personalized treatment plans.
Furthermore, AI-powered systems are improving healthcare accessibility by supporting telemedicine platforms and remote diagnostics, especially in rural and underserved areas.
Key Trends in Artificial Intelligence Development in Healthcare
The rapid evolution of AI technologies has introduced several new trends in healthcare innovation. These trends are shaping the future of digital healthcare solutions.
- AI-Powered Medical Diagnostics
AI-powered diagnostic tools are revolutionizing how doctors detect diseases. Machine learning algorithms can analyze medical images such as CT scans, X-rays, and MRIs to identify abnormalities with high precision.
For example, AI systems can detect early signs of cancer, cardiovascular diseases, and neurological disorders faster than traditional diagnostic methods. These systems assist radiologists by highlighting suspicious areas in medical images and reducing the risk of misdiagnosis.
Advanced AI diagnostic tools also improve workflow efficiency in hospitals by automating image analysis and reducing the workload on medical professionals.

- Predictive Analytics for Preventive Healthcare
Preventive healthcare is becoming one of the most important applications of AI. Predictive analytics uses historical patient data, lifestyle information, and genetic profiles to forecast potential health risks.
AI models can identify patients who are at risk of developing chronic con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, or cancer. This allows healthcare providers to intervene early and prevent complications.
Predictive analytics also helps hospitals identify high-risk patients who are likely to be readmitted, enabling proactive treatment strategies that improve patient outcomes and reduce healthcare costs.
- Personalized Medicine
Personalized medicine is another major trend driven by AI. Instead of providing a one-size-fits-all treatment, AI systems analyze genetic data, medical history, and lifestyle factors to create customized treatment plans for individual patients.
AI-based genomic analysis can identify disease-causing mutations and predict how patients will respond to specific medications. This helps doctors select the most effective therapies while minimizing side effects.
Personalized medicine is especially valuable in cancer treatment, where AI can recommend targeted therapies based on a patient’s genetic profile.
- Virtual Health Assistants and AI Chatbots
AI-powered virtual assistants are becoming increasingly popular in healthcare applications. These digital assistants provide 24/7 patient support by answering medical questions, scheduling appointments, and sending medication reminders.
AI chatbots also help reduce the burden on healthcare staff by automating routine interactions with patients. They can perform symptom assessments and guide patients toward appropriate medical care.
Virtual assistants play a crucial role in telemedicine platforms, making healthcare services more accessible and efficient.
- AI in Drug Discovery and Research
Drug discovery is traditionally a long and expensive process that can take more than a decade. AI is accelerating this process by analyzing chemical compounds and predicting how they interact with biological systems.
AI algorithms can identify potential drug candidates and simulate clinical trials, significantly reducing research time and costs. Pharmaceutical companies use AI to analyze massive biological datasets and discover new treatments for complex diseases.
AI-powered drug discovery is helping scientists develop innovative therapies faster, ultimately improving patient care.
- AI-Driven Remote Patient Monitoring
Remote patient monitoring has become a critical component of modern healthcare systems. AI-powered wearable devices and IoT sensors collect real-time health data such as heart rate, blood pressure, oxygen levels, and glucose levels.
AI algorithms analyze this data to detect anomalies and alert healthcare providers before a medical emergency occurs. This technology is particularly useful for managing chronic conditions like diabetes, hypertension, and heart disease.
Remote monitoring systems also enable doctors to track patient progress without requiring frequent hospital visits, improving convenience and reducing healthcare costs.
- AI-Powered Robotic Surgery
Robotic surgery systems powered by AI are transforming surgical procedures. These systems assist surgeons by providing real-time data analysis and enhanced precision during operations.
AI-powered surgical robots can analyze imaging data and guide surgeons through complex procedures while minimizing damage to surrounding tissues. Studies show that AI-assisted surgeries can reduce complications and shorten recovery times.
As robotic surgery becomes more advanced, it will play a major role in improving surgical outcomes and patient safety.
Real-World Use Cases of AI in Healthcare
Artificial Intelligence is already being used in various healthcare applications across the world. Here are some of the most impactful use cases.
Early Disease Detection
AI-powered diagnostic tools can detect diseases at an early stage by analyzing medical imaging and patient data. Early detection significantly improves treatment success rates and reduces healthcare costs.
For example, AI systems can identify early signs of breast cancer, lung cancer, and Alzheimer’s disease before symptoms appear.
AI-Based Clinical Decision Support
Clinical decision support systems (CDSS) use AI algorithms to assist doctors in making informed medical decisions. These systems analyze patient data, medical guidelines, and research studies to recommend the most effective treatment options.
Doctors use AI-powered CDSS to reduce diagnostic errors and improve patient care.
Healthcare Workflow Automation
Administrative tasks such as medical coding, insurance claims processing, and electronic health record documentation consume a significant amount of healthcare professionals’ time.
AI-powered automation tools can handle these tasks efficiently, allowing doctors and nurses to focus more on patient care. Automated EHR documentation and data extraction significantly reduce manual errors and improve healthcare efficiency.
AI in Mental Health Support
AI-powered mental health applications provide therapy support through chatbots and digital counseling tools. These applications help patients manage stress, anxiety, and depression by offering cognitive behavioral therapy techniques and emotional support.
Such tools are particularly valuable for individuals who may not have easy access to mental health professionals.
Telemedicine and Virtual Care
Telemedicine platforms powered by AI enable remote consultations, symptom checking, and patient triage. AI algorithms help prioritize patient cases and recommend appropriate treatments.
This technology improves healthcare accessibility, especially in rural areas where medical specialists may not be readily available.
Challenges of AI in Healthcare
Despite its benefits, implementing AI in healthcare comes with several challenges.
Data Privacy and Security
Healthcare data is highly sensitive, and protecting patient information is critical. AI systems must comply with strict regulations such as HIPAA and GDPR to ensure data security.
Algorithm Bias
AI models rely on training data. If the data is biased, the AI system may produce inaccurate results or unequal treatment recommendations. Ensuring diverse datasets is essential for fair healthcare outcomes.
Regulatory Compliance
Healthcare AI solutions must undergo rigorous regulatory approvals before deployment. Compliance requirements vary across different countries and healthcare systems.
